The Youth Organiser of the Wenchi constituency of the opposition New Patriotic Party in the Brong Ahafo region, Richard Adu Kwadwo, has stated that the level of frustrations and desperation which the youth of this country have endured under the current government should be enough reason for them to lead an onslaught against the re-election bid of President Mahama and his governing NDC in the December polls.
According to the youth leader who doubles the Assembly Member of the Ntoase Electoral area in Wenchi, this year's elections is about the protection of the future of the youth in Ghana, for which reason they should lead the change agenda.
He said the NDC government had shown that it has no regard for the youth of the country and their progress; hence it remains a patriotic national duty for the youth to vote it out this December.
Speaking exclusively with the Daily Statesman yesterday, the constituency youth leader was of the firm view that until there was a change in government in December, there would be absolutely no life again for the youth of Ghana.
Lack of jobs for the youth, he noted, was evident in the fact that apart from the high numbers of unemployed graduates in the country, who are crying over their inability to land jobs, universities and polytechnics are releasing into the system other batch of youth who will come and compound the situation. Yet, the government is clueless in creating jobs for them, he notes.
Richard Adu Kwadwo said the only way of restoring hope and confidence was for them to vote for change, a change that would benefit them and make their dreams a reality.
According to him, President Mahama and his government have always shown that they don’t have the interest of the youth at heart, adding that any mistake to retain them will spell doom for the future that they have hoped for.
In his view, the monies that have gone waste due to corruption could have created enough financial pool that could have created sustainable jobs for the people.
"But due to wickedness and greed, only few cronies are enjoying our sweat. This tells us that they did not come for us but themselves. The NPP under Kufuor worked for the wellbeing of the youth but this is not the case under this corrupt government," Mr Adu lamented.
To him, a programme like the National Youth Employment Programme was the first to be targeted by the NDC for destruction through corrupt practices.
According to him, the change the country seeks this year is a change from corruption, incompetence, massive unemployment among the youth and insensitivity, stressing "we are only assured of a brighter future if we kick this government out and bring in the NPP."
He charged on the teaming youth of Ghana to get involved in ensuring that President Mahama and the NDC the red card, and ensure that the NPP forms the next government in 2017, under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o.
